My Buying Guide on 12 Volt Fuel Pump
When I decided to purchase a 12 Volt fuel pump, I realized that there are several important factors to consider. Whether you need it for a car, boat, or any other application, I found that understanding the features, types, and specifications can make all the difference. Here’s what I learned during my journey.
Understanding the Basics
Before diving into the specifics, I took the time to understand what a 12 Volt fuel pump is. It’s a device that moves fuel from the tank to the engine, powered by a 12 Volt electrical system. This is common in most vehicles and equipment, making it vital for various applications.
Types of 12 Volt Fuel Pumps
I discovered that there are primarily two types of 12 Volt fuel pumps:
- Electric Fuel Pumps: These are used in modern vehicles and are known for their efficiency and reliability. I found them to be quieter and capable of delivering fuel at a consistent pressure.
- Mechanical Fuel Pumps: These are typically found in older cars and are driven by the engine’s crankshaft. They’re simpler but may not be as efficient as electric pumps.
Key Features to Consider
When I was comparing different pumps, I focused on several key features:
- Flow Rate: This is measured in gallons per hour (GPH) and indicates how much fuel the pump can deliver. I made sure to choose one that matched my engine’s requirements.
- Pressure Rating: Measured in pounds per square inch (PSI), this indicates how much pressure the pump can produce. I learned that higher pressure isn’t always better; it should align with my engine’s specifications.
- Material Quality: The construction of the pump matters. I looked for pumps made from durable materials like aluminum or high-quality plastics to ensure longevity.
- Noise Level: I preferred a quieter pump, especially since I planned to use it in a confined space.
Compatibility
I made sure to check the compatibility of the pump with my vehicle or equipment. This included ensuring that the fittings and connections matched. I also considered the voltage and amperage specifications to avoid any electrical issues.
